Thumbs up My "Newest" Marker

Being the person that I am, and the fact that one marker just isn't enough to satisfy my cravings, I decided to pick up a "new" used marker. While it's close to being done, I still have a few more tidbits to add. I picked up this Blazer in a trade, and it had a check up from Palmers prior to being shipped to me.

Here's what it has on it, or for it so far:

12" Dual Ported, Black Powdercoated Brass Barrel (.690 bore)
10" Brass Barrel (.685 bore)
Palmers Apex Adapter
Foregrip
45 grip frame w/ blade trigger
7* asa
quick disconnect on the steel braided end that connects to the reg

In addition to this, a previous owner had milled the dovetail rail. While it looks good like this, they left it with the aluminum showing. So I did a quick patchup paint job on it until I can get it annoed black.







I got the Blazer a few days ago, and was able to play with it yesterday. It shoots exceedingly fast for a mech, and the shots were dead on. I was using Co2 the entire time we played, and literally put ball on top of ball at ranges far beyond what I'm use to.

Unfortunely I don't have a hopper for it yet so I had to borrow a gravity fed one from a buddy...... and the Blazer shoots so fast that the gravity fed one could not keep up with it. The good news is that I have a hopper on the way to me that I ordered.

The Blazer it literally the best marker I've ever shot, or even owned for that matter. It's also tiny and light compared to the A-5. I have no clue what took me so long to get one, but I'm glad I finally did.
